well i got it running!!



i didn't put it on a base due to lack of suitable metal :(

its rough and ready and i've learned a lot! i ran it for a few minutes, took it to pieces and cleaned it all. it would then run by blowing (hard !!) in to the feed pipe.

i was over come then, stuck the airline gun on to the inlet, i managed to forget i'd let the compressor run to 100 PSI, it went mental!! i was mesmorised :bugeye: :bugeye: next thing was a loud pop and the piston and conrod made a break for freedom.

put it all back together and it runs a treat. i'm inspired to go for another build now.......... just got to decide what! and do a neater job :D
